/// <summary> /// 作者:Kylin /// 时间:2014.07.31 /// 描述:查询学员学习累积进度详情 /// </summary> /// <param name="branchId"></param> /// <param name="saId"></param> /// <param name="searchDate"></param> /// <param name="productSCode"></param> /// <param name="rateCourses"></param> /// <returns></returns> public static List<StudentStudyProgressDetail> GetSaSTudentStudyProgressDetailStat(int? branchId, int saId, DateTime searchDate, string productSCode, decimal rateCourses) { using (var edb = new EmeEntities(dbRead)) { return edb.GetStudentStudyProgressDetail(saId, searchDate, productSCode, rateCourses, branchId).Select(p => new StudentStudyProgressDetail() { UserId = p.UserId, UserCName = p.UserCName, UserEName = p.UserEName, SAId = p.SAUserId, ContractBeginDate = p.ContractBeginDate, CurrentLevel = p.CurrentLevel, StatusType = p.StatusType, StudyTotal = p.StudyTotal, HighStandardNum = p.HighStandardNum, HighUsualNum = p.HighUsualNum, LastStudyCourse = p.LastStudyCourse, LastStudyDate = p.LastStudyDate, OprDate = p.OprDate, VIP = p.VIP, MC = p.MC, PC = p.PC, AC = p.AC, MP = p.MP, WR = p.WR, MBG_AC = p.MBG_AC, MBG_PC = p.MBG_PC, LMW = p.LMW, TP = p.TP, ProductSCode = productSCode, RateCourses = rateCourses, BranchId = branchId }).ToList(); } }